快速下载:MySQL单机版安装指南
mysql单机版下载

首页 2025-07-14 06:09:13



MySQL单机版下载:打造高效数据管理的基石 在当今数字化时代,数据已成为企业最宝贵的资产之一

    如何高效地存储、管理和分析这些数据,直接关系到企业的运营效率和决策质量

    MySQL,作为一款开源的关系型数据库管理系统(RDBMS),凭借其高性能、可靠性和灵活性,在全球范围内赢得了广泛的认可和应用

    本文将深入探讨MySQL单机版的下载与安装,以及它如何成为您数据管理旅程中的强大基石

     一、MySQL单机版简介 MySQL最初由瑞典公司MySQL AB开发,后于2008年被Sun Microsystems收购,最终成为Oracle Corporation的一部分

    尽管经历了所有权变更,MySQL始终保持着其开源特性,免费向公众提供基础版本,同时提供企业级服务和支持选项,满足不同规模企业的需求

     MySQL单机版,顾名思义,是指在一个物理服务器或虚拟机上运行的MySQL数据库实例

    它适用于中小型企业、个人开发者、学习及测试环境等场景,提供了所有核心数据库功能,包括数据定义、数据操作、数据查询、数据控制及事务处理等

    相较于分布式或集群部署,单机版以其部署简单、维护成本低廉而著称

     二、为何选择MySQL单机版 1.开源免费:MySQL基础版本完全免费,且源代码开放,这意味着您可以自由地使用、修改和分发它,大大降低了初期投入成本

     2.高性能:经过数十年的优化,MySQL在处理大量数据和高并发访问方面表现出色,尤其适合Web应用、数据仓库等多种场景

     3.跨平台兼容性:MySQL支持多种操作系统,包括Windows、Linux、macOS等,确保在不同环境下的灵活部署

     4.丰富的社区支持:作为全球最流行的开源数据库之一,MySQL拥有庞大的用户社区和丰富的文档资源,遇到问题时能迅速获得帮助

     5.强大的扩展性:虽然以单机版起步,但随着业务需求增长,MySQL可以轻松过渡到主从复制、集群等高级架构,实现高可用性和可扩展性

     三、MySQL单机版下载指南 1.访问官方网站 首先,访问MySQL官方网站(https://dev.mysql.com/downloads/),这是获取最新、最安全版本的官方渠道

    页面顶部导航栏提供了“Downloads”选项,点击进入下载页面

     2. 选择下载版本 在下载页面,您会看到多个MySQL产品系列,包括MySQL Community Server(社区版)、MySQL Enterprise Edition(企业版)等

    对于大多数用户而言,MySQL Community Server是最合适的选择,因为它是免费的,并且包含了所有核心功能

     接下来,根据您的操作系统类型(Windows、Linux、macOS等)选择相应的版本

    对于每个操作系统,MySQL还提供了多种安装包格式,如MSI安装程序、ZIP归档文件、RPM包、DEB包等,根据您的具体需求选择合适的格式

     3. 阅读并接受许可协议 在下载之前,务必仔细阅读MySQL软件许可协议

    同意协议后,才能继续下载过程

     4. 下载并安装 点击“Download”按钮后,浏览器将开始下载MySQL安装包

    下载完成后,根据您的操作系统执行相应的安装步骤: -Windows:双击MSI安装程序,按照向导提示完成安装

    注意选择安装类型(如典型安装、自定义安装),并配置MySQL服务账户、端口号等

     -Linux:解压ZIP归档文件或使用包管理器(如yum、apt)安装RPM/DEB包

    安装后,通过`mysql_secure_installation`脚本进行安全配置,如设置root密码、移除匿名用户等

     -macOS:下载DMG文件后,将其挂载并打开,将MySQL拖动到应用程序文件夹中

    然后,通过终端运行安装脚本完成安装和配置

     5. 启动MySQL服务 安装完成后,需要启动MySQL服务

    在Windows上,可以通过服务管理器启动MySQL服务;在Linux/macOS上,则通常使用`systemctl start mysqld`或`service mysqld start`命令

     6. 连接MySQL数据库 启动服务后,您可以使用MySQL客户端工具(如MySQL Workbench、命令行客户端等)连接到数据库

    首次连接时,通常使用root账户和安装过程中设置的密码

     四、MySQL单机版优化与安全管理 虽然MySQL单机版部署简单,但为了充分发挥其性能并确保数据安全,以下几点优化与安全管理措施至关重要: 1.配置优化:调整MySQL配置文件(如`my.cnf`或`my.ini`)中的参数,如内存分配、缓存大小、日志文件设置等,以适应您的特定工作负载

     2.定期备份:使用mysqldump、`xtrabackup`等工具定期备份数据库,以防数据丢失

    考虑实施自动化备份策略,确保备份的及时性和可靠性

     3.访问控制:创建必要的数据库用户,并为每个用户分配最小权限原则

    使用强密码策略,并定期更新密码

     4.日志监控:启用并监控MySQL错误日志、查询日志、慢查询日志等,及时发现并解决潜在问题

     5.安全更新:定期检查MySQL官方网站的安全公告,及时应用安全补丁,防范已知漏洞

     6.性能调优:利用MySQL自带的性能分析工具(如`EXPLAIN`、`SHOW STATUS`、`SHOW VARIABLES`)和第三方工具(如Percona Toolkit)进行性能诊断和优化

     五、展望未来:从单机到集群 随着业务的发展,单机版MySQL可能会遇到性能瓶颈或高可用性问题

    此时,您可以考虑向更高级的架构过渡,如主从复制、MySQL Group Replication、MySQL InnoDB Cluster等,以实现读写分离、故障转移和数据一致性

    Oracle提供的MySQL Shell、MySQL Router等工具,可以大大简化这些高级配置的部署和管理

     结语 MySQL单机版以其开源、高效、灵活的特点,成为众多企业和开发者数据管理的首选

    通过正确的下载、安装、配置与优化,MySQL不仅能够满足当前的数据存储和处理需求,还能为未来的扩展和升级奠定坚实的基础

    在这个数据驱动的时代,选择MySQL,就是选择了可靠、高效的数据管理解决方案

    立即行动,下载MySQL单机版,开启您的数据管理新篇章!

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道